Paris: French President Macron says that US and Israeli attacks cannot solve the problem of Iran's nuclear program, and diplomacy is the only way out.
French President Emmanuel Macron discussed the latest
situation regarding Iran and the Strait of Hormuz during his visit to South Korea.
He says that if there is no clear framework for diplomatic and technical
negotiations, the situation could deteriorate again in a few months or years.
He added that such an operation would take an extraordinary
amount of time and that those passing through the Strait of Hormuz would face
coastal threats, ballistic missiles and other threats from the Iranian
Revolutionary Guard Corps, which has sufficient resources.
